Enanta Pharmaceuticals Inc is a biotechnology company that uses a chemistry-based drug discovery approach to develop small-molecule candidates for virology and immunology applications. It focuses on Virology and Immunology. Its active development programs in virology are focused on respiratory syncytial virus, or RSV, and SARS-CoV-2, and Hepatitis B virus. In immunology, the company is engaged in designing and developing potent and selective, oral small molecule inhibitors for the treatment of type 2 inflammatory disease. The company has collaborated with AbbVie, which markets its protease inhibitor paritaprevir, with additional inhibitors in development. The company generates the majority revenue in the form of royalty revenue.
Gogo Inc is a broadband connectivity service for the business aviation market. It provides a customizable suite of smart cabin systems for integrated connectivity, inflight entertainment, and voice solutions. Its business segment includes Gogo BA and Satcom Direct. It generates two types of revenue: service revenue consists of monthly subscription and usage fees paid by aircraft owners and operators for telecommunication, data, and in-flight entertainment services, and equipment revenue consists of proceeds from the sale of ATG and narrowband satellite connectivity equipment and is recognized when control of the equipment is transferred to OEMs and dealers, which generally occurs when the equipment is shipped.
